			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>On December 18 and 19, 2009 the AuSable Valley Central School Boys basketball team held their  4th Annual  tourney called Hoops for Hope. Led by Coach Jamie Douglas, they raised $925 for Hospice of the North Country and $ 925 for an ALS patient from our their area. Teams in the tournament this year were” AuSable Valley, Westport , Willsboro , and Harwood Highlanders of Vermont.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Under the guidance of Ogdensburg FA Coach (and BCANY Board member) Bill Merna, BCANY’S first Service Game was held in December.  The game between Ogdensburg and Indian River was a test run of what a BCANY Service Game might entail.  BCANY is going to hold Service Games based on the very successful Endowment Games in North Carolina and Foundation Games in Ohio.</p>
<p>The Ogdensburg FA school gave permission to collect donations and have a 50-50 at the game. On Wednesday the captains read what the teams was doing on the daily school announcements over the intercom. On Thursday and Friday the players manned a table outside the cafeteria that had informational posters on the Wounded Warrior Project. In 2 days they collected $153 from students and staff.<br />
The game was Saturday &#8211; posters were by the door and a donation jar was displayed. Another $105 was taken in there. There was a good crowd at the game against Indian River. Their district is on the edge of Fort Drum and has many residents in the military. The 50-50 raffle took in $333 so we netted $166.50. The total was $424.50 &#8211; this has been sent to the Wounded Warrior Project.<br />
 <br />
Ogdensburg finished the Service game by volunteering at the local Am-Vets. They prepare, serve, and distribute to shut-ins a Christmas dinner. The local paper had some nice articles about the Service Game.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>During basketball season at Hamilton High School, spectators typically focus on the players. This season, however, all eyes were on varsity basketball coach David Rhyde.</p>
<p>Well, not as much on Rhyde as his neckties.</p>
<p>Thanks to a friendly suggestion by Rhyde family physician David Haswell, whose son is the team captain, spectators donated ties for Rhyde to wear at each game.</p>
<p>But in order for the tie to be wearable, the donor first had to make a contribution to the American Cancer Society.</p>

<p>By Hamilton&#8217;s final regular-season game Rhyde had collected a diverse array of neckties in all sizes, colors and patterns. His wardrobe includes bow ties, one sporting Disney cartoon character the Tasmanian Devil, Darth Vader, a variety of 1970s throwbacks, even a bolero.</p>
<p>The endeavor has generated team spirit and raised more than $1200. for the cancer society.</p>
<p>&#8220;A lot of this is the community,&#8221; said Rhyde, who also works for the village of Hamilton. &#8220;I think they got the idea they could get rid of all their ugly ties. But I&#8217;m going to put them in a pile, take a picture and send them back to their owners.&#8221;</p>
<p>Throughout the season, tie fever spread like wildfire.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Allegany-Limestone HS, Girls &#8211; Coach Frank Martin reports that they “held our Coaches vs. Cancer events the same week as all others (two nights &#8211; a girls and boys home event) and raised $175.00. We then decided to give it to lady from our community who is battling cancer, an Allegany graduate whose children attended this school as well, Beverly Giardini. She is on chemotherapy now after surgery in Rochester. Though not a huge sum of money, it is making a difference in her life. The photo is of our boys and girls captains&#8217; presenting her the money.”</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Olean HS- Girls Coach and Athletic Director Don Scholla reports that Olean HS held two &#8220;Coaches vs. Cancer&#8221; events, the boys &#8220;Coaches vs. Cancer&#8221; game was held on Friday 1/23/09 and the girls game was held on the following Friday 1/30/09. All of the basketball coaches and the visiting team coaches participated by wearing sneakers while coaching to help raise awareness about cancer prevention and early detection. &#8220;Coaches vs. cancer&#8221; cards to those who donated and some &#8220;coaches vs. cancer&#8221; bracelets that we sold as well. For the girls game some &#8220;breast cancer awareness&#8221; sweatbands were purchased and worn during the game by players from both teams. The Olean girls wore pink sweatbands and the visiting Falconer girls wore white bands. The bands had the &#8220;breast cancer awareness&#8221; pink ribbon embroidered on them. All in all, with the generous help of the Olean Sports Boosters Club two very successful &#8220;coaches vs. cancer&#8221; games were held at OHS.</p>
